This book offers the representative macroeconometric models and their applications for the Japanese economy in different development stages throughout the postwar years up to the present.

It presents a summary of three types of macroeconometric models and analyses:As many Asian economies are going through the stages of development that Japan has experienced over the past few decades, this book will be extremely relevant to them and other developing countries as a reference for years to come.
